Mandy Patinkin American actor and singer
To my father, for not telling him the truth when he was diagnosed with pancreatic cancer and going along with the family lie that he had hepatitis, when he knew he didn’t. At the age of 17, I lacked the courage and strength to stand up for what I believed.
